Galley style kitchen layout

Small Kitchen Design Ideas whether you have a narrow space or a large open plan kitchen, the galley style can be a fantastic cooking space. The key to designing a galley-style kitchen is to find ways to maximize space and add functionality to a small area. Whether you choose to add a breakfast bar, a peninsula, or custom built in seating, your galley can be a stylish and functional space for cooking and entertaining.

The right galley style kitchen design ideas can make any kitchen a showpiece. Here are a few tips and tricks to help you plan your next galley kitchen remodel.

Choose a color scheme that will coordinate across the worktops. Bright, warm hues will create a bright and airy space. White is a perfect complement to warm tones.

You can make your galley kitchen look bigger by incorporating bright lighting. A ceiling-hung chandelier is a great way to add a touch of glamour to your space. Under-cabinet lighting is also a great way to add light without taking up too much space.

One-wall kitchen layout

Often referred to as the “ultimate space saver,” one-wall kitchen design ideas are a great option for homes with limited space. These layouts combine all the major cooking functions into a single area. This saves space by eliminating the need to join counters. This makes a one wall kitchen perfect for studio apartments and large houses with open floor plans.

In addition to maximizing space, one wall kitchen design ideas also offer a contemporary aesthetic. The design is simple and allows for creative storage solutions. It is also ideal for kitchens that may have limited counter space. This design can also be used in a great room to create an attractive visual component.

The kitchen area in one wall kitchen design ideas is organized around a three-point line, which allows the user to move between major areas. These include food preparation, the kitchen counter, and the sink. This arrangement makes it easy for the cook to get everything they need.

Traditional kitchen design ideas

Traditionally designed kitchens have a unique charm that can be hard to find in other types of kitchens. Their timeless style means that they will never go out of style. These kitchens have a warm, welcoming feel and can be extremely versatile.

Usually, these kitchens incorporate natural elements, such as stone and wood countertops. They are also often decorated with decorative accents, such as ornate pendant lighting and chandeliers.

Another way to achieve a traditional look is by using a faux chimney. This look consists of a faux chimney hood that conceals an extractor fan and gives the appearance of a traditional-style chimney breast.

Other traditional kitchen design ideas include a kitchen island. This is a focal point that can be used to display a variety of items, including an antique oil painting, an antique china cabinet or a rustic oak table.

A kitchen island is also a great place to put a wrought iron pendant light. This type of lighting can tie in with the colors of the hardware. This is a great way to update your traditional kitchen in a snap.

Eco-friendly kitchen design ideas

Creating an eco-friendly kitchen is a great way to protect the environment and save money. Using energy-efficient appliances and materials helps save on electricity and water.

Eco-friendly kitchen design ideas can include the use of natural, organic materials, reclaimed wood, and recycled materials. These materials are environmentally friendly, reducing the amount of waste that goes into landfills.

When selecting kitchen materials, consider the impact of the materials on the environment over the lifetime of the kitchen. Recycled materials use less energy to manufacture than new products. For example, countertops made from recycled glass can add a calming, serene feel to a kitchen. Another material that is eco-friendly is cork. Cork is soft and absorbent, and it does not release toxic chemicals into the air. It is resistant to water, dust, and heat.

Kitchen cabinets and countertops can also be made from recycled materials. Some home improvement companies have dedicated lines to products that are environmentally friendly. You can also find recycled materials online.
